Pros

Its airconditioned in the summer (though too much sometimes), and heated in the winter.

Cons

The upper management is paranoid and because of that micromanages every aspect of clients. Advice is given more to confuse and mistakes are held over everyone but the partner's heads. Managers and staff are not treated as adults, nor are they given leeway to try other management techniques. How upper management acts and what it says it wants to do are diametrically opposed to each other. They say they want a work life fit, but want everyone working 12-14 hours a day. What the partners charge the clients are far too small in relation to some of the work that needs to be done, and when budgets are consistently blown, it is not the partner's fault for not charging appropriately, but the staff's fault for not being more efficient, even when the staff was working on the client for 30 hours strait.

Pros

There actually are great people, but you play manager roulette.

Cons

BDO is notorious for promoting people who just never leave. The middle of the road, not great, not awful, people get promoted over and over again. There have been changes every 3 seconds since the ESOP. Terrible communication around change (non-existent). My manager's favorite term was "We are building the plane as we fly it". After 4 years, I was hoping to have more plane built. It was never built.
